Canon Powershot G3 X Superzoom Delivers 24-600mm Lens, Gut-Punching $999 Price
Despite it's compact size, the Powershot G3 X comes with an f/2.8-5.6, 25x Optical Power Zoom lens that's equivalent to 24-600mm. That should let photographers get pretty close to the action, even when sitting in the nosebleeds seats at a sporting event. And if you're feeling shaky from all that caffeine, Canon says the improved Intelligent Image Stabilization system provides virtually shake-free images in a variety of shooting conditions.

Other features include an ISO range of 125-12,800, a proprietary DIGIC 6 image processor that's supposed to do well in low light situations, 3.2-inch multi-angle capacitive touch panel LCD with 1.62 million dot resolution, high-speed auto-focus with 31 widely spread AF points for fast action shots, 1080p recording with live HDMI output, built-in Wi-Fi, and NFC support.

It's not a bad assortment of features, though the $999 asking price puts the Powershot G3 X in contention with some D-SLRs that sit just above the entry-level point.
